WebOpen the Command Palette ( Ctrl+Shift+P) and use Docker: Add Docker Files to Workspace... command: Select Node.js when prompted for the application platform. Choose the default package.json file. Enter 3000 when prompted for the application port. Select either Yes or No when prompted to include Docker Compose files.
